Brocade Services Director 17.2 released

PaulWallace
Contributor

In this new release, Brocade Services Director supports configurations where Services Director is running behind NAT. In addition, this release has been designated as an LTS (Long Term Support) release. Summary:

  • NAT deployment support: This is suitable for cloud configurations where the front-end IP address differs from the actual IP address, or where Services Director is deployed in a private network, to manage ADC services outside the private network.

  • Long-Term Support release: For customers who prefer longer support cycles to support their operational model, Brocade is identifying Brocade Services Director 17.2 as an LTS (Long Term Support) release. As a result, support for Brocade Services Director 17.2 will be available for three years after the release date.

Version Numbering:
Since January 2017, Brocade software products use the version number convention “YY.n”, where YY is the year of release and n is the sequential release for that year. This release of Services Director is designated "17.2" - following directly from the previous Services Director release, which was designated "17.1"
